One should define a cost function …

1. Specific enough

To define the boundaries of the search space.

Example: Define the dose limits for the OAR over the whole

dose range.

2. General enough

Not to artificially restrict the solution space

Example: if you want to obtain a specific OAR mean dose,

do not set objectives for this OAR with DVH points.

Common sense and implicit knowledge must be made explicit
